NEW DELHI: The engine of a goods train derailed in Uttar Pradesh's Sitapur on Tuesday, an official said.

The incident happened around 7 a.m. when the train was somewhere between the Sitapur city and cantonment stations. 

"It was the middle engine of the goods train which derailed... Two engines were being used for the train," the senior railway official told IANS. 

The official also said the of Burhwal-Balamau passenger train had also derailed in the same area on Monday. No casualties were reported. The affected mainline traffic was still being restored.
